Aux Charpentiers
10 rue Mabillon
(6e)
tel.: 01-43-26-30-05
Location: 6e
Cuisine: French
Price Category: Inexpensive

This battered veteran attracts those seeking the Left Bank Paris of yesteryear. The bistro, opened more than 130 years ago, was once the rendezvous of the carpenters whose guild was next door. Nowadays young men bring their dates here. Though the food isn't especially imaginative, it's well prepared in the tradition of cuisine bourgeoise -- hearty but not effete. Appetizers include paté of duck and rabbit terrine. Especially recommended is the roast duck with olives. The plats du jour recall French home cooking: salt pork with lentils, pot-au-feu, and stuffed cabbage. The wine list has a large selection of Bordeaux, including Château Gaussens.

Main courses 15€-22€; prix fixe 19€ at lunch, 25€ at dinner.Open: Daily noon-3pm and 7-11:30pm.Reservations required.Credit Cards: AE, DC, MC, V.Métro: St-Germain-des-Prés.
